Il Nonno
Il Nonno has a thin inspection record, with only one visit on file so far. Il Nonno was last inspected on May 1, 2024. A high risk rating points to multiple serious findings at the most recent inspection.
Evidence of rats or live rats in establishment's food comes up most often, recorded one time in the inspection record.
Il Nonno's latest score of 50 falls below the Queens average of 75. Taken together, the history suggests a facility that has struggled with consistency.
